Negotiations between leaders The EU and Zelensky failed: there is no money for Ukraine

Vladimir Zelensky, Keir Starmer, Friedrich Merz and Emmanuel Macron. Photo: Tolga Akmen / EPA / Shutterstock

Negotiations between leaders The EU and Vladimir Zelensky, which took place in Germany the day before, ended in failure. The issue of further financing of Ukraine has not been resolved. This is reported by Spiegel.

"The Europeans failed to find a solution to the financing problems. At a meeting of supporters of Ukraine with President Zelensky on the sidelines of a conference in Munich, Berlin's proposal to use more than 90 billion euros of frozen Russian assets for further arms purchases in the United States failed,"the newspaper writes.

According to the information, this happened during a critical phase for the Ukrainian Armed Forces, whose ammunition is running out.

"During the conflict, there is nothing more alarming for the leader of the country than the words of the Air Force commander that the anti—aircraft guns are not ready for combat," the publication quotes Zelensky as saying at the conference.

According to the publication, due to difficulties at the front, the head of the Kiev regime had to change his rhetoric towards European partners, whom he had previously criticized at the Davos forum. His new wave of indignation was directed at the Joe Biden administration, which no longer affects anything.
